Chemically Lamictal is an anti seizure and is not related with other drugs against the use of anticonvulsants that regulates mood. It is found that Lamictal antidepressant has relatively more power than valproate or carbamazepine. The approval of Lamictal for use as a treatment for people with bipolar disorder is given by the FDA in 2003.

People who did not receive adequate relief from lithium, carbamazepine or valproate for bipolar mixed states and rapid cycling were able to control the use of Lamictal.
